GL.iNet GL-MT3000 up to 4.4.5 Online Firmware Upgrade one_click_upgrade command injection

Detailsinfo

A vulnerability was found in GL.iNet GL-MT3000 up to 4.4.5. It has been classified as critical. This affects an unknown functionality of the file /usr/bin/one_click_upgrade of the component Online Firmware Upgrade Handler. The manipulation with an unknown input leads to a command injection vulnerability. CWE is classifying the issue as CWE-77. The product constructs all or part of a command using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ended command when it is sent to a downstream component. This is going to have an impact on confidentiality, integrity, and availability.

The advisory is shared at github.com. This vulnerability is uniquely identified as CVE-2026-12187. The exploitability is told to be easy. It is possible to initiate the attack remotely. Technical details and a public exploit are known. MITRE ATT&CK project uses the attack technique T1202 for this issue.

The exploit is shared for download at github.com. It is declared as proof-of-concept. The vendor was contacted early, responded in a very professional manner and quickly released a fixed version of the affected product.

Upgrading to version 4.7 eliminates this vulnerability. The upgrade is hosted for download at fw.gl-inet.com.
